The "Seven Little Blessings" of Childhood

"Seven Little Blessings" is a Peking Opera, but also a drama class, but also a general term for the famous Peking Opera master Wu Sheng zhan Yuan's protégé. There are a total of 14 members, in addition to the often mentioned seven people, there are also Yuan De, Yuan Wu, Yuan Jun, Yuan Tai, Yuan Zhen, Yuan Bao, Yuan Qiu and others. Only with the passage of time, now looking back at this group of division brothers, Yuan Jun, Yuan Tai, and Yuan Wu disappeared in the early 1980s; Yuan Zhen and Yuan Bao were only mixed in the film world and were unknown; and Hong Jinbao, Jackie Chan, Yuan Biao, Yuan Kui, Yuan Hua, Yuan De, and Yuan Bin became the most prominent figures in today's Xiangjiang film industry, so the "Seven Little Blessings" in the eyes of the public were naturally specific to the seven of them.

If you subdivide it again, the clearest memories are Yuan Long (Hong Jinbao), Yuan Lou (Jackie Chan) and Yuan Biao.

Yuan Biao, formerly known as Xia Lingzhen, grew up in a well-off family.

The reason why he joined the Seven Little Blessings was different from Jackie Chan, Hong Jinbao and other brothers.

Jackie Chan was thrown into it to reinvent himself because of his mischievous childhood;

Hong Jinbao, because of his family's inheritance, his grandmother is Qian Xiangying, China's first generation of martial arts actresses and famous Actors in Hong Kong.

Xia Lingzhen is because of interest.

It is said that When Boss Xia was 5 or 6 years old, he followed his father to see the play, and after the show, he couldn't help but be overjoyed, and he learned martial arts in a similar way, turning his head on the stage, don't say, the translation is good, and the characters in the theater garden all say that this baby has talent.

After a discussion, you have to, since you are interested, then try it.

As a result, Xia Lingzhen officially joined the Chinese Academy of Drama Studies in Hong Kong and became Yu Zhanyuan's protégé, named Yuan Biao.

He was young, and after entering the drama school, he was loved by the master, and other teachers and brothers could not see him and often bullied him. For example, he was borrowed by his master brother Hong Jinbao and could not pay it back; he was robbed of the villain book by Yuan Kui. Jackie Chan stood up for him, and as a result, the two were beaten up by Hong Jinbao.

Of course, this group of division brothers is not internal discord, it is all a joke between children. Even if Hong Jinbao cleaned him up, he still respected the master brother very much, and at the same time, he could still worship with Yuan Kui.

From this point of view, Yuan Biao is a clever little man in the drama school, everyone bullies him, and everyone likes him.

In 1971, the drama school collapsed, and the master Yu Zhanyuan went to the United States, still taking Yuan Biao with him.

During those days, Yuan Biao lived with his master selling video tapes, and he was miserable.

Due to his fortune and injury, Hong Jinbao left the drama school earlier, entered the film circle, and slowly gained a foothold.

With the departure of Bruce Lee, Hong Kong kung fu films have entered the barbaric era, and the kung fu pit left by Bruce Lee is urgently waiting for someone to replace it, but the difficulty is really not small, after all, the cut boxing has beaten the former kung fu to the ground, accelerating the innovation and change of Hong Kong kung fu films.

Many Liyuan disciples, martial arts students, saw the opportunity and wanted to become the "second Bruce Lee", and they entered the martial arts and began to pursue their dreams.

Jackie Chan stumbled out.

Therefore, Hong Jinbao and Jackie Chan felt that their lives were bitter and could not cheapen the honest disciple, so they dragged Yuan Biao in.

Yuan Biao is different from them, he is young, ambitious, his positioning of himself is on the "martial finger", this side of a dragon set, there to help guide, the opportunity to be pushed.

Yuan Biao | Left Hong Jinbao, Jackie Chan's day 1234

Hong Jinbao and Yuan Biao on the set of "Miscellaneous Boys"

In 1979, Hong Jinbao dragged Yuan Biao hard to shoot "Miscellaneous Boys".

Unexpectedly, Yuan Biao, suddenly became red.

He was 22 years old.

However, Yuan Biao chose a more difficult path.

In 1986, Yuan Biao established Jiahe's subsidiary "Taihe", and co-produced and starred in "Law Enforcement Pioneer" with Yuankui, which was a good harvest, so he wanted to imitate Hong Jinbao's "Baohe" and get out of Jiahe's control.

Yuan Biao | Left Hong Jinbao, Jackie Chan's day 1234

Yuan Biao in "Law Enforcement Pioneer"

Hong Jinbao dared to do this because he was at ease in the industry, which made Jiahe "jealous", and Yuan Biao now wants to come out?

Snow hide.

Under Jiahe's order, Jackie Chan never saw Yuan Biao again in his movie, and then he was even more controlled, and Yuan Biao was "disappeared".

At the same time, after the trial and error of "Shaolin Temple", "Shaolin Kid" and Shaw's works, Jet Li became the darling of capital, and in the kung fu theme, he shared the world equally with Jackie Chan.

Yuan Biao chose to go on the road again, he set up a new company to shoot "Tibet Kid", and tried to turn around, resulting in a box office failure.

In 1993, Yuan Biao moved to Canada, and within a few years, it was even more invisible.
